The Left Won't Be One Bit Happy About the Latest USS Abraham Lincoln Development

- • The USS George Washington is replacing the USS Abraham Lincoln in the Middle East.
- • The Lincoln has been deployed for over 250 days without a port call.
- • Crew members face significant fatigue, sanitation issues, and mental health strain.
The carrier was redirected to the region in January 2026 due to tensions with Iran. This extended deployment has caused unprecedented strain on sailors and their families.
